"History forgotten. That is what's at stake for present and future
generations if adequate funding is not found for the Underground
Railroad Network to Freedom program (NTF). This program was created to
educate the public about the critical journey of sacrifice and triumph
that has empowered African-Americans and helped shape the history of
this nation. Despite its importance, the program has been funded at
levels well below sustainability--and at current levels the program
could disappear within a decade."  Support Congressional bill H.R.
1239.
